CMPT 135 Assignment 3: Chatbots

Assignment 3: Chatbots In this assignment your task is to implement and test a number of different chatbots. Each different chatbot is implemented in a class that inherits from the Chatbot base class given below. Getting Started For this assignment, all the code you write should be put into a file named a3.cpp that looks…

Turing Test

After a recent conversation with a chatbot, I had an opportunity to see how the bot would hold up against the Turing Test. The chatbot was subjected to pseudo-random questions, each meant to see what the bot’s response would be. The bot exhibited refined ability to understand and respond to questions, even managing to decipher emotion based on the tone of the human user.
A number of questions